  3. Open the video editor to blur a section of your video. Sign in to YouTube Studio. From the left menu, select Content . Click the title or thumbnail of the video you’d like to edit. From the left menu, select Editor . Add face blur. Under the “Video editor” section, select Blur select Face blur.

  6. Android/iOS. To blur Google Street View you must send a request. Find your home in Google Maps. Open the Street View image that you want to blur. In the bottom right, click 'Report a problem'.
